Latest Patents

Vaiden's notable invention is a gear motor decoupling device, which addresses the challenges faced in conventional gear motor systems. The device features a coupler member that can move axially on the output shaft of the gear motor, allowing it to cooperate effectively with the final gear of the gear train located within the motor housing. A spring mechanism ensures engagement of the coupler with the final gear, while a self-securing pivotally mounted yoke facilitates disengagement through controlled axial movement. This inventive design allows for seamless connection and disconnection of the jaw structures on the output shaft, providing a reliable solution for various applications in cargo movement.
